Posted by mbeimer on Saturday August 22, 2009 at 11:55 PMKrypton is a clear, colorless, and tasteless non-metallic gas. It has an atomic number of 36, meaning it has 36 protons in the nucleus. It is found in group 18 of the periodic table known as the noble gases. These gases are inert (unreactive) due to their stable electron configuration.
Krypton is found in small quantities in the air. It is used in lighting and photography.
